Students on the BA Irish and Politics will combine advanced learning of the Irish language with a study of Politics. You may choose from a wide range of modules in Irish such as film-making, the short story, poetry, and Gaelic identity. Politics examines areas such as conflict, co-operation, theories of society, the value and ethical basis of political ideas and action, and at politics in different national and historical contexts.
